Sharon looked at Leonard gratefully, her heart warm. 

Shirley and Selena sat on the sofa upstairs, none of them looking quite happy.

However, compared to Selena, Shirley knew how to keep her emotions of her face. 

Suddenly, footsteps came from upstairs.

Shirley jerked and immediately turned to look upstairs. 

All she saw was Sharon running out of the study room and into her own room. After a moment, she ran out again with something in her arms and entered the study room again. 

With a bang, the door of the study room closed before Shirley's eyes.

Shirley's fingers subconsciously dug into her palm. She slowly turned around and lowered her head to stare blankly at the floor.

Seeing that Sharon could freely enter Leonard's study room, Selena scowled in dissatisfaction, her hands tugging on the sofa harshly. 

......

By 11 at night, both of them had yet to emerge from the study room.

Selena kept looking at the clock on the wall and back to the study room on the second floor. 

Shirley, on the other hand, kept her head low. Her face was covered by her long locks so it was impossible to tell what expression she had at that moment. 

The sound of footsteps approached.

Shirley's eyelids twitched, and she opened her eyes. 

It was the driver, Nick Collins. He gave them a respectful nod. "It's getting late. Sir has instructed me to send both of you back."

"What?" Selena exclaimed in a tearful voice.

She had intentionally came to visit Leonard, but he had headed for the study room right after dinner and hasn't come out since then, and she's too scared to go upstairs and disturb him.

Selena felt very hurt and her eyes turned red.

A cold glint flashed in Shirley's for a split second before she hid it. She turned to Selena and said with a gentle smile, "We must have chosen a bad time to visit. Since your brother is busy today, let's visit another day."

Selena bit into her lower lip and lifted her head to look at the first floor. She stood up furiously and stomped towards the door. 

Shirley merely narrowed her eyes and lifted her head before getting up and leaving as well.
